What is UPVC?

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ride (UPVC) is a type of plastic that is rigid and resilient. Unlike PVC, which can be versatile, UPVC is created to be rigid and is often used in building due to its strength and resistance to ecological aspects. UPVC is made by getting rid of plasticizers from PVC, which boosts its stability and lowers the threat of destruction in time.

Benefits of UPVC Windows and Doors

  1. Durability and Longevity

    • Resistant to Weathering: UPVC is highly resistant to climate condition, consisting of UV radiation, wetness, and temperature level variations. This makes it a perfect product for both seaside and inland areas.
    • Corrosion-Resistant: Unlike metal, UPVC does not rust or wear away, making sure that the windows and doors keep their stability over time.
    • Low Maintenance: UPVC windows and doors need very little upkeep. A basic wipe with a damp cloth is normally adequate to keep them looking brand-new.
  2. Energy Efficiency

    • Insulation: UPVC is an excellent insulator, assisting to maintain a consistent indoor temperature level. This can lead to considerable energy savings on heating and cooling expenses.

  3. Security

    • Tough Construction: UPVC frames are strong and tough to break, supplying an extra layer of security.
    • Multi-Point Locking Systems: Many UPVC doors and windows included multi-point locking systems, which enhance security by locking the frame at multiple points.
  4. Aesthetic Appeal

    • Versatile Designs: UPVC can be formed into different shapes and sizes, allowing for a wide range of design options. It can be used to develop both modern-day and standard styles.
    • Color Options: UPVC can be colored during the manufacturing process, providing a variety of color choices to match any home's visual.
  5. Economical

Maintenance of UPVC Windows and Doors

While UPVC windows and doors are low maintenance, routine care can extend their lifespan and guarantee ideal performance. Here are some upkeep suggestions:

  1. Cleaning:

    • Regular Wiping: Use a wet cloth to clean down the frames and glass surfaces to get rid of dust and dirt.
    • Avoid Abrasive Cleaners: Use moderate soap and water for cleansing.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can damage the surface area.
  2. Inspection:

    • Check Seals: Regularly examine the seals for wear and tear. Replace any broken seals to keep energy performance.
    • Lubricate Moving Parts: Lubricate hinges and other moving parts to ensure smooth operation.
  3. Repairs:

    • Prompt Repairs: Address any issues, such as broken locks or damaged frames, quickly to prevent additional damage.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. Are UPVC doors and windows environmentally friendly?

    • UPVC is recyclable, and numerous producers utilize recycled materials in the production procedure. Additionally, the energy effectiveness of UPVC doors and windows can decrease a structure's carbon footprint.
  2. Can UPVC windows and doors be painted?

    • While UPVC can be painted, it is not suggested as the paint can peel and break over time. It is best to select a color during the manufacturing procedure.
  3. How do UPVC windows and doors compare to wood ones?

    • UPVC doors and windows are usually more resilient and require less upkeep than wooden ones. They are also more resistant to weathering and pests.
  4. Are UPVC doors and windows appropriate for all climates?

    • Yes, UPVC windows and doors are ideal for a large range of climates due to their resistance to temperature fluctuations and wetness.
  5. How long do UPVC doors and windows last?

    • With appropriate maintenance, UPVC windows and doors can last for 20-30 years or more.
